About The Position

Assists program participants in developing occupational and vocational goals reflective of their skills, capabilities and interests. Manages participant progress towards achieving goals by creating and updating plans. Manages a caseload of participants and provides counseling and mentoring. Assesses participant competencies, work history, educational attainment, skills, and abilities; identifies challenges to finding employment and prompts them to find solutions. Conducts regular ongoing individual meetings with participants for job search, education, job retention, and/or job readiness. Completes an individualized overview of available services and works with participant to create an employment plan for short- and long-term goals. Maintains information about area resources and employers. Ensures participant accountability and attendance; tracks and maintains employment retention goals. Maintains scheduled, periodic contact with participants in a variety of locations to assess job retention/advancement issues. Provides information to participants on available training and/or jobs that will lead to advancement. Assumes central responsibility for participants achieving self-sufficiency by monitoring progress throughout the program cycle, beginning with referral and continuing through retention and advancement efforts. Prepares, organizes, and maintains accurate, updated information in both electronic and paper participant files reflecting the entire history of a program participant including log of supportive services issued. Provides case management with a focus on helping customers to prepare for employment that leads to self-sufficiency. Facilitates customer access to training, education, and to employment services, as well as job-specific information; provide case management to customers at the appropriate level.
